Asbestos isn't a big concern, as long as you take precautions... even a simple dust mask will help a lot, and that's recommended anyways.


A simple dust mask weill not provide enough protection from Asbestos, only a P-100 filter with a form fitting facemask is recomended even in stilghtly comtaminated areas. It is true that people can get huge doses of it and be fine, but there are people who go into a room where there is only one linolium tile with asbestos in it and low and behold they have lung cancer in a year. As long as you don't disturb it, make a dust, rub up against it, etc., you should be fine, but be safe and get a P-100 filter. It also protects againts 99.7 organic compounds. For your kit, id try to keep it to a minimum. Id go with a flashlight, a respirator, a cell phone, some extra batteries, and maybe a bottle of water.

A camera can be a good prop, especially if your 14. You can just say that you were shooting photos for a school project and hope the person cuts you some slack.
